About Taiwan Geometry Symposium

The purpose of the Taiwan Geometry Symposium is to foster discussions and interactions within the geometry community in Taiwan. It hopes to meet regularly in the years to come, running on a Saturday from late morning to late afternoon, with 3-4 speakers.
The activity will rotate among Taipei, Hsin-Chu and Tainan. We encourage everyone who is interested in Geometry, and particularly students, postdoctoral fellows and young scholars to participate in the Symposium. This semester's symposium will be held at National Changhua University of Education (國立彰化師範大學) on March 24, 2018.
